If I prepay next year's real estate tax on a rental property this year, can I deduct it as a rental expense on this year's taxes?

I would pay it directly to the tax collector's office. Next year's property taxes won't be billed and due until early next year, but the tax office has given me an estimate for next year's tax and said I could send them a check this year.  My mortgage company collects escrow for taxes and will refund me any excess next year (after they see that the tax bill shows the tax has already been paid).  The question is whether I could deduct the prepayment on this year's taxes.
